Osmosis is the movement of water through a semipermeable membrane,from a region of low solute concentration to one of high solute concentration.
Negative Feedback System
A regulatory mechanism in which a change in a system's output acts to stabilize or reduce further change.
Positive Feedback System
A system in which a change in some steady state triggers a response that intensifies the changing condition. Compare with negative feedback system.
Set Point
A theory suggesting that the body regulates physiological functions, such as temperature or weight, around a specific homeostasis level or 'set point'.
Stressor
Any biological, chemical, physical, or psychological factor that causes stress to an organism, potentially leading to disease or harm.
